Last year at Le Vin en Tete in Paris, we were lucky to find the delicious Menu Pineau "Haut Plessis" from Christophe Foucher's Domaine La Lunotte. Foucher’s vineyards are located on the southern bank of the Cher River, near St. Aignan, just a few miles from our friends at Clos Roche Blanche. Foucher farms seven distinct plots planted to Sauvignon Blanc, Menu Pineau, Gamay and Cabernet Franc; everything is done by hand at this 7 hectare Domaine and the farming is organic; this is lots of work considering it’s just Christophe… The wines are aged in small, used barrels and have a certain creaminess and weight that magically balances their high acidity and intense minerality. Bottling is done by hand, without pumping and without added sulfur. Exactly the type of wines that make us love what we do here at Chambers.
